Our Biosocial Brains: The Cultural Neuroscience of Bias, Power, and Injustice Michele K. Lewis
Our Biosocial Brains: The Cultural Neuroscience of Bias, Power, and Injustice
Michele K. Lewis
Michele Lewis, inspired by African-Centered psychologists and psychiatrist Frantz Fanon, argues for a more humanistic cultural neuroscience to further understandings of the influence of isolation, injustice, power, and bias on brains and behavior.
